Arunachal PAT - Polytechnic Admission Test

Arunachal PAT (Polytechnic Admission Test) is a state-level entrance examination conducted by the Arunachal Pradesh Directorate of Higher & Technical Education (APDHTE). This test is designed to assess the aptitude and foundational knowledge of candidates aspiring to join polytechnic diploma programs in various technical and engineering fields. Polytechnic courses provide practical, hands-on technical education, preparing students for careers in engineering and technology while offering a cost-effective alternative to traditional higher secondary and full engineering degree pathways. By performing well in Arunachal PAT, candidates can secure admission to reputable polytechnic institutes in the state, gaining early exposure to technical skills and a strong foundation for future academic or professional pursuits.

The syllabus for Arunachal PAT is generally drawn from the Class 9–10 level curriculum, aligned with the state’s academic guidelines or national boards like CBSE. Key focus areas include:

  • Mathematics:
    • Basic Concepts: Numbers, operations, fractions, decimals, percentages.
    • Algebra: Linear equations, simple polynomials, patterns.
    • Geometry: Basic shapes, angles, perimeter, area, volume.
    • Data Handling: Graphs, charts, basic statistics.
  • Science:
    • Physics: Motion, force, energy, basic electricity, and light.
    • Chemistry: States of matter, mixtures, simple chemical reactions, acids, and bases.
    • Biology/General Science: Cell basics, human body, plants and animals, environment, and ecosystems.
  • Note: Topics and depth may vary slightly based on the state’s curriculum. Candidates should refer to the official syllabus provided by APDHTE for detailed and updated content.

  • Practical Technical Training: Polytechnic courses emphasize hands-on learning through workshops and labs, preparing students for technical roles in industry.
  • Early Job Opportunities: Diploma holders can secure technical or junior engineer positions even before pursuing further studies, enabling early financial independence.
  • Cost-Effective Education: Polytechnic education is generally less expensive compared to full-time engineering degrees, especially in government institutions.
  • Lateral Entry to Engineering: Diploma holders can later join B.Tech or B.E. programs through lateral entry into the second year, reducing the total duration to become an engineer.
  • Government Recruitment: A diploma qualifies students for various government job exams and positions in technical and engineering fields, including roles in Public Sector Undertakings (PSUs).
